Biobased Polymers

One of the most popular bio-based packaging materials is biobased polymers, which are derived from renewable resources such as corn starch, sugarcane, and cellulose. From these materials it is possible to create almost any type of packaging like doypack, flat bottom pouches and other. Biobased polymers have several advantages over traditional petroleum-based plastics, including reduced carbon emissions, lower toxicity, and improved biodegradability.

Biobased polymers are versatile and can be used in a variety of applications, including food packaging, personal care products, and consumer goods. These materials are safe, sustainable, and cost-effective, making them an attractive option for businesses looking to reduce their environmental impact.

Bio-Based Smart Materials

Bio-based smart materials are an exciting development in the world of packaging. These materials are designed to be responsive to their environment, changing their properties in response to temperature, humidity, or other stimuli.

Bio-based smart materials have several applications in the packaging industry, including moisture control, temperature control, and antimicrobial properties. These materials are sustainable and offer significant advantages over traditional packaging materials, making them an ideal choice for businesses looking to reduce their environmental impact.
